
No injuries were reported after emergency crews responded to a semi trailer fire west of Sweet Springs early Tuesday, June 17.
Firefighters with the West Central Fire District responded around 3 a.m. to the report of a fire along the westbound lanes of Interstate 70, about a half-mile west of Sweet Springs. According to a post on the district’s Facebook page, the trailer contained “very flammable material”. Crews took about seven hours to extinguish the flames and secure the trailer and its contents. Traffic on westbound I-70 was diverted to an outer road to allow first responders to access the scene. The district commended the Sweet Springs Ambulance District, Sweet Springs Police, Missouri State Highway Patrol, and the sheriff’s departments for both Saline and Lafayette counties for their assistance.
